Sri Lanka Tourism Roadshow Held in Saudi Arabia’s Eastern Province After a Decade

Sri Lanka’s tourism sector marked a significant return to Saudi Arabia’s Eastern Province with a promotional roadshow held recently after a ten-year hiatus. The event, which witnessed the participation of a large number of Destination Management Companies (DMCs), was organised by the Sri Lankan Embassy in Riyadh in collaboration with the Sri Lanka Tourism Promotion Bureau. It was the second event of its kind to be held in the Kingdom.

The roadshow included a networking session between 20 visiting Sri Lankan DMCs and their Saudi counterparts, facilitating potential partnerships and expanding the scope of tourism cooperation between the two countries.

Sri Lankan Ambassador to the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, Ameer Ajwad, emphasized that the Eastern Province represents a promising market for Sri Lanka’s tourism industry, with strong potential for growth and collaboration.

As part of the initiative, the Sri Lankan Embassy in Riyadh launched a new Arabic-language Snapchat account named “Jannat Dunya” — which translates to “Paradise on Earth” — dedicated to promoting Sri Lanka’s tourism offerings to Arabic-speaking audiences.
